EU Legal Acts Statistics by Type and Year
Summary
The European Union's EUR-Lex portal has updated its statistics on legal acts. This notice provides access to data on adopted, repealed, and expired legal acts, categorized by year and type, including basic and amending acts.
What changed
The EUR-Lex portal has published updated statistics regarding the EU's legal acts. The data allows users to consult the number of legal acts adopted, repealed, and expired, broken down by year and month. It distinguishes between basic acts and amending acts, and covers acts that are currently in force and those no longer in force. Corrigenda are excluded from these figures.
This is a routine statistical update and does not impose new obligations on regulated entities. Compliance officers may use this data for informational purposes to understand the volume and types of legislation being enacted within the EU. No specific action is required.

Legal acts – statistics
Consult, by year and by month, the number of legal acts adopted in a given month as well as those repealed and expired in a given month.
For adopted acts, both those in force and those no longer in force are covered. There
are separate figures for basic acts and amending acts (acts amending previously adopted
acts*). The figures are based on the date an act was adopted. Corrigenda are excluded.
The figures for repealed acts and expired acts are based on the end of validity date.
Non-legislative acts are in italics.

- For bibliographical reasons, an act is classified as an amending act if according to its title it amends one or more acts, even if it also contains autonomous provisions.
** The vast majority of decisions have addressees (a Member State, a group of Member
States, one or more companies). According to Article 288 of the Treaty on the Functioning
of the European Union (TFEU) a decision which specifies those to whom it is addressed
shall be binding only on them.
*** Ephemeral acts are excluded. Acts related to day-to-day management of agricultural
matters (‘ephemeral acts’) are generally valid for a limited period of time. Since
1 March 2011 they have been mainly adopted as Commission implementing regulations.
Before that date they were mainly adopted as Commission regulations.
**** ECB Guidelines are legal instruments adopted in accordance with Article 12.1 of the
Protocol (No 4) on the Statute of the European System of Central Banks and of the European
Central Bank
